## This module implements URI parsing as specified by RFC 3986.
##
## A Uniform Resource Identifier (URI) provides a simple and extensible
## means for identifying a resource. A URI can be further classified
## as a locator, a name, or both. The term “Uniform Resource Locator”
## (URL) refers to the subset of URIs.
##
## Basic usage
## ===========
##
## Combine URIs
## -------------
## .. code-block::
## import uri
## let host = parseUri("https://nim-lang.org")
## let blog = "/blog.html"
## let bloguri = host / blog
## assert $host == "https://nim-lang.org"
## assert $bloguri == "https://nim-lang.org/blog.html"
##
## Access URI item
## ---------------
## .. code-block::
## import uri
## let res = parseUri("sftp://127.0.0.1:4343")
## if isAbsolute(res):
## echo "Connect to port: " & res.port
## # --> Connect to port: 4343
## else:
## echo "Wrong format"

@@ -24,11 +53,18 @@ proc encodeUrl*(s: string, usePlus=true): string =
## This means that characters in the set
## ``{'a'..'z', 'A'..'Z', '0'..'9', '-', '.', '_', '~'}`` are
## carried over to the result.
## All other characters are encoded as ``''%xx'`` where ``xx``
## All other characters are encoded as ``%xx`` where ``xx``
## denotes its hexadecimal value.
##
## As a special rule, when the value of ``usePlus`` is true,
## spaces are encoded as ``'+'`` instead of ``'%20'``.
## spaces are encoded as ``+`` instead of ``%20``.
##
## **See also:**
## * `decodeUrl proc<#decodeUrl,string>`_
runnableExamples:
assert encodeUrl("https://nim-lang.org") == "https%3A%2F%2Fnim-lang.org"
assert encodeUrl("https://nim-lang.org/this is a test") == "https%3A%2F%2Fnim-lang.org%2Fthis+is+a+test"
assert encodeUrl("https://nim-lang.org/this is a test", false) == "https%3A%2F%2Fnim-lang.org%2Fthis%20is%20a%20test"

proc decodeUrl*(s: string, decodePlus=true): string =
## Decodes a URL according to RFC3986.
##
## This means that any ``'%xx'`` (where ``xx`` denotes a hexadecimal
## This means that any ``%xx`` (where ``xx`` denotes a hexadecimal
## value) are converted to the character with ordinal number ``xx``,
## and every other character is carried over.
##
## As a special rule, when the value of ``decodePlus`` is true, ``'+'``
## As a special rule, when the value of ``decodePlus`` is true, ``+``
## characters are converted to a space.
##
## **See also:**
## * `encodeUrl proc<#encodeUrl,string>`_
runnableExamples:
assert decodeUrl("https%3A%2F%2Fnim-lang.org") == "https://nim-lang.org"
assert decodeUrl("https%3A%2F%2Fnim-lang.org%2Fthis+is+a+test") == "https://nim-lang.org/this is a test"
assert decodeUrl("https%3A%2F%2Fnim-lang.org%2Fthis%20is%20a%20test", false) == "https://nim-lang.org/this is a test"
